hMailServer supports all the major email protocols you would need: SMTP (for sending), POP3 and IMAP (for receiving). It is designed to run as a background Windows service and comes with an intuitive administration tool for management and backup.
: Unlike older versions, 5.7 is built for x64 systems, allowing it to leverage more system memory and modern processor capabilities. Prerequisites : Before installation, ensure your server has the .NET Framework installed via the Windows "Add Roles and Features" wizard. Database Connectivity : If you are using , you must manually obtain the 64-bit libmysql.dll
: As of 2023, the original hMailServer project is no longer being actively developed by its creator. download hmailserver 5.7
If you choose an external database, you will need the server name, database name (pre-created), username, and password.
: Because it is 64-bit, you must use 64-bit database clients (such as libmysql.dll ) to connect to external databases like MySQL. hMailServer supports all the major email protocols you
Run the downloaded hMailServer-5.7.x executable file with full Administrator privileges. Accept the licensing agreement and click .
Once the installation is complete, open the tool to finalize your deployment. Adding a Domain Prerequisites : Before installation, ensure your server has
Verify the file checksum if provided to ensure installer integrity. Step 2: Running the Installer